Appendix Safety precautions For your safety and security and to prevent damage, carefully read the following safety instructions. This 'Safety precautions' relate to Chromebook use. Some of the content may not be applicable to your Chromebook. • Since this is commonly applied to Samsung Chromebooks, some pictures may differ from actual products. • The product mentioned in this guide refers to all items supplied with the Chromebook including the battery, the adapter, and all other Samsung-provided accessories. Warning Failure to follow the instructions marked with this symbol may result in physical injury or fatality. Power related Handle the power cord with care. • Do not touch with wet hands. • Do not use a damaged power cord. • Do not overload a multi-outlet or an extension cord beyond the specified voltage/current capacity. • Firmly insert the power cable into the adapter. • Do not unplug the power cord by pulling on the cable. • Unplug the wall-mount adapter (integrated plug and power adapter) from the wall outlet while holding the body and pulling it in the direction of the arrow. Failure to do so may result in electric shock or fire. Connect the power cord to the adapter firmly. An improper connection may result in a fire. Use the approved adapter or cable included in the product box. If you use the unapproved adapter or cable, it cause the damage or malfunction of the Chromebook. NP UM Rev 5.0 38
